This black commemorative plaque records: Carpenter Close (St Wilfred's) These buildings, derelict for a decade, were redeveloped by Exeter City Council Radford Cruse Aggett Architects L.Aggett RIBA Designer Recorded plaque organisation: Exeter Civic Society.
Carpenter Close represents a significant urban regeneration project in Exeter, showcasing the collaborative efforts between local government and architectural firms to revitalize neglected areas.
